|
Accounts and notes payable and accruals and other current liabilities
|12 Months Ended
Dec. 31, 2023
|Accounts and notes payable and accruals and other current liabilities
|Accounts and notes payable and accruals and other current liabilities
|
10. Accounts and notes payable and accruals and other current liabilities
Accounts and notes payable consist of the following:
Accruals and other current liabilities consist of the following:
As of December 31, 2023, contract liabilities are primarily derived from the contracts with enterprise customers for the new business initiative. Substantially all of the balance of contract liabilities are generally recognized as revenue within one year.
|X
- Definition
+ References
The entire disclosure for accounts payable, accrued expenses, and other liabilities that are classified as current at the end of the reporting period.
+ Details
No definition available.
|X
- References
+ Details
No definition available.